1. Composition and Chemistry

Alkaline primary batteries are made with zinc and manganese dioxide, immersed in an alkaline electrolyte, usually potassium hydroxide. This unique chemical mix contributes to their high energy density and long shelf life. According to battery expert Dr. Emily Carter, "Understanding the chemistry behind alkaline batteries helps one appreciate their efficiency in various devices."

Component Function
Zinc Anode material; provides electrons in the chemical reaction.
Manganese Dioxide Cathode material; accepts electrons to complete the circuit.
Potassium Hydroxide Electrolyte that facilitates ion movement and enhances conductivity.

2. Voltage Output and Capacity

Typically, alkaline batteries deliver a nominal voltage of 1.5 volts. However, actual performance may vary based on the load and temperature conditions. According to battery analyst Mark Thompson, "The capacity can range between 1500 to 3000 mAh, depending on factors like discharge rate and usage environment."

3. Shelf Life and Storage

One of the standout features of alkaline batteries is their impressive shelf life, which can last up to 10 years when stored properly. Jeffries Logan, a well-known tech reviewer, highlights, "Storing batteries in a cool, dry place maximizes their lifespan, ensuring they are ready for use when needed." Be mindful of the expiration date printed on the packaging.

4. Environmental Impact

Alkaline batteries are generally considered less harmful to the environment compared to other battery types. They do not contain heavy metals such as cadmium or lead. Environmental scientist Dr. Susan Miller states, "Recycling alkaline batteries is often easier, and many municipalities have programs to facilitate this process. It’s crucial to dispose of batteries responsibly to minimize environmental impact."

5. Common Applications

Alkaline primary batteries are used widely across numerous devices, such as:

  • Remote controls
  • Flashlights
  • Toys
  • Smoke detectors
  • Portable electronics

Influencer Samantha Green emphasizes, "The versatility of alkaline batteries makes them a household essential, powering everything from kids' toys to critical safety devices."

6. Comparison with Other Battery Types

When considering battery options, it’s vital to compare alkaline batteries with other types, such as lithium-ion. Below is a summary comparison:

Feature Alkaline Batteries Lithium-Ion Batteries
Cost Lower Higher
Voltage 1.5V 3.7V
Rechargeability No Yes
Shelf Life Up to 10 years 2-3 years

7. Safety and Handling

Alkaline batteries are generally safe to handle, but it is essential to follow basic safety precautions. Notably, avoid mixing different battery types, and never attempt to recharge non-rechargeable alkaline batteries. Battery safety expert Lisa Brown advises, "Always check for leakage or damage before use, and dispose of batteries at designated recycling centers."
